Master-thesis: A geological investigation on bedrock suitability for mineral carbonation conducted in the south central part of Sweden

by Edvard Pearson, Luleå University of Technology, 2023

This study aims to investigate the suitability of areas located in the south-central part of Sweden for in-situ mineral carbonation, a relatively newly implemented method of permanently storing carbon dioxide. The project has been conducted in connection with the research project INSURANCE at Luleå University of Technology, which has as one of its main objectives to investigate the geological potential for land-based carbon dioxide storage in Sweden. Samples were taken from five different localities in the southern-central part of Sweden. Fifteen representative field samples were then examined with optical microscopy, whole rock geochemistry analysis, scanning electron microscopy (SEM), and micro-XRF in order to characterize the area’s bedrock with respect to their potential suitability for in-situ mineral carbonation.
